diff --git a/crypto/openssl/doc/apps/spkac.pod b/crypto/openssl/doc/apps/spkac.pod deleted file mode 100644 index bb84dfbe3352..000000000000 --- a/crypto/openssl/doc/apps/spkac.pod +++ /dev/null @@ -1,127 +0,0 @@ -=pod - -=head1 NAME - -spkac - SPKAC printing and generating utility - -=head1 SYNOPSIS - -B<openssl> B<spkac> -[B<-in filename>] -[B<-out filename>] -[B<-key keyfile>] -[B<-passin arg>] -[B<-challenge string>] -[B<-pubkey>] -[B<-spkac spkacname>] -[B<-spksect section>] -[B<-noout>] -[B<-verify>] - - -=head1 DESCRIPTION - -The B<spkac> command processes Netscape signed public key and challenge -(SPKAC) files. It can print out their contents, verify the signature and -produce its own SPKACs from a supplied private key. - -=head1 COMMAND OPTIONS - -=over 4 - -=item B<-in filename> - -This specifies the input filename to read from or standard input if this -option is not specified. Ignored if the B<-key> option is used. - -=item B<-out filename> - -specifies the output filename to write to or standard output by -default. - -=item B<-key keyfile> - -create an SPKAC file using the private key in B<keyfile>. The -B<-in>, B<-noout>, B<-spksect> and B<-verify> options are ignored if -present. - -=item B<-passin password> - -the input file password source. For more information about the format of B<arg> -see the B<PASS PHRASE ARGUMENTS> section in L<openssl(1)|openssl(1)>. - -=item B<-challenge string> - -specifies the challenge string if an SPKAC is being created. - -=item B<-spkac spkacname> - -allows an alternative name form the variable containing the -SPKAC. The default is "SPKAC". This option affects both -generated and input SPKAC files. - -=item B<-spksect section> - -allows an alternative name form the section containing the -SPKAC. The default is the default section. - -=item B<-noout> - -don't output the text version of the SPKAC (not used if an -SPKAC is being created). - -=item B<-pubkey> - -output the public key of an SPKAC (not used if an SPKAC is -being created). - -=item B<-verify> - -verifies the digital signature on the supplied SPKAC. - - -=back - -=head1 EXAMPLES - -Print out the contents of an SPKAC: - - openssl spkac -in spkac.cnf - -Verify the signature of an SPKAC: - - openssl spkac -in spkac.cnf -noout -verify - -Create an SPKAC using the challenge string "hello": - - openssl spkac -key key.pem -challenge hello -out spkac.cnf - -Example of an SPKAC, (long lines split up for clarity): - - SPKAC=MIG5MGUwXDANBgkqhkiG9w0BAQEFAANLADBIAkEA1cCoq2Wa3Ixs47uI7F\ - PVwHVIPDx5yso105Y6zpozam135a8R0CpoRvkkigIyXfcCjiVi5oWk+6FfPaD03u\ - PFoQIDAQABFgVoZWxsbzANBgkqhkiG9w0BAQQFAANBAFpQtY/FojdwkJh1bEIYuc\ - 2EeM2KHTWPEepWYeawvHD0gQ3DngSC75YCWnnDdq+NQ3F+X4deMx9AaEglZtULwV\ - 4= - -=head1 NOTES - -A created SPKAC with suitable DN components appended can be fed into -the B<ca> utility. - -SPKACs are typically generated by Netscape when a form is submitted -containing the B<KEYGEN> tag as part of the certificate enrollment -process. - -The challenge string permits a primitive form of proof of possession -of private key. By checking the SPKAC signature and a random challenge -string some guarantee is given that the user knows the private key -corresponding to the public key being certified. This is important in -some applications. Without this it is possible for a previous SPKAC -to be used in a "replay attack". - -=head1 SEE ALSO - -L<ca(1)|ca(1)> - -=cut |
